riva cem is a self-curing, radiopaque, fluoride releasing paste/paste resin modified glass-ionomer luting material. It is indicated for permanent cementation of metal-based and strengthen-core ceramic restorations, and orthodontic appliances.

  • Working time – 1’45”

  • Setting time – 4’30”

  • Shear bond strength (MPa) – Dentin – 13.03 ± 3.40

  • Shear bond strength (MPa) – Enamel- 9.99 ± 3.17

  • Compressive strength (MPa) -108

Light tack cure option for quick and easy removal of excess cement

Light cure any excess material for 5 seconds per surface using a high power LED curing light (460-480nm emission). Then gently remove it using a scaler
or explorer. Excess can also be easily removed during self-curing gel stage (when cement feels rubbery),
after 1 min 45 seconds.

High bond strength

rivacemhas excellent adhesion to dentine, zirconia and titanium, making it ideal for the cementation of ceramic and metal based indirect restorations.
Its high bond strength ensures long term retention of restorations.
